Charles E. “Chuck” Griffith, Jr., 86, of Rumson for many years, passed away on Sunday, March 10, 2024.

Born and raised in New York City to Charles and Amalie Griffith, Chuck graduated high school from Westminste­r School in Simsbury, CT and from Hamilton College, both of which he remained a supportive alumnus over the years.

Serving in the United States Army Reserves from 1962 to 1966, Chuck worked for many years in banking and was dedicated to giving back to his community through his commitment to volunteeri­ng. As a Rotarian, he drew from the principles of the Rotary Internatio­nal Four-Way Test - embracing truth, fairness, good will and friendship, ensuring that everything he did would be beneficial to all concerned. He served as Treasurer of the YMCA, the Monmouth Boat Club and was a volunteer tax accountant at Fort Monmouth. A devoted baseball, soccer, and ice hockey coach, Chuck was the 1st President of the Matawan-Aberdeen Soccer League and served on the Boards of the American Cancer Society and Planned Parenthood for many years. While Chuck thoroughly enjoyed a good round of golf and open-water sailing, he held closest to his heart the time spent with his devoted family, whether attending life events, activities and athletic contests of his children and grandchild­ren, or sharing precious time at family gatherings.

Predecease­d by his parents and by his first wife, Susan Wilkins Griffith, Chuck is survived by his beloved wife of 40 years, Nancy Griffith; his loving children, Jennifer Griffith Black and husband Brian, Charles E. Griffith III and wife Jeannie and Kate Griffith; his cherished grandchild­ren of whom he was incredibly proud, Kathryn, Carson, Tommy, McKenzie, Susan, Jack and Bray; his two younger brothers and their families, Alan Griffith and wife Penny and David Griffith and wife Jacqui and a host of beloved brothers and sisters-in-law, nieces, nephews, cousins and friends.
